Job Description
Role Overview:
We are seeking a Data Scientist / AI Specialist with 1-3 years of experience to be part of our team and contribute to client projects in the Automotive & Industrial sectors. Your role will involve utilizing traditional Machine Learning (ML), Generative AI (GenAI), Agentic AI, and Autonomous AI Systems to drive innovation, optimize processes, and enhance decision-making in complex industrial environments. While prior experience in the Auto/Industrial industry is beneficial, candidates from any domain with a strong analytical mindset and a passion for leveraging AI in real-world business challenges are encouraged to apply.
Key Responsibilities:
- Develop, deploy, and monitor AI/ML models in production environments & enterprise systems, encompassing predictive analytics, anomaly detection, and process optimization for clients.
- Utilize Generative AI models (e.g., GPT, Stable Diffusion, DALLE) for diverse applications such as content generation, automated documentation, code synthesis, and intelligent assistants.
- Implement Agentic AI systems, including AI-powered automation, self-learning agents, and decision-support systems tailored for industrial applications.
- Design and construct Autonomous AI solutions targeting tasks like predictive maintenance, supply chain optimization, and robotic process automation (RPA).
- Handle structured and unstructured data from various sources like IoT sensors, manufacturing logs, and customer interactions.
- Optimize and fine-tune Large Language Models (LLMs) for specific business applications, ensuring ethical and explainable AI use.
- Employ MOps and AI orchestration tools to streamline model deployment, monitoring, and retraining cycles.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ams, comprising engineers, business analysts, and domain experts, to align AI solutions with business objectives.
- Stay abreast of cutting-edge AI research in Generative AI, Autonomous AI, and Multi-Agent Systems.
Qualifications Required:
- Bachelor/Masters degree in Statistics/Economics/Mathematics/Computer Science or related disciplines with an excellent academic record or MBA from top-tier universities.
- Minimum 1-3 years of relevant experience in Data Science, Machine Learning, or AI-related roles.
